What does rice pudding taste like?

Rice pudding is a comforting and versatile dessert that can have a variety of flavors depending on the recipe. Here's a general description:

Basic Rice Pudding:

* Sweet and creamy: The rice absorbs the milk and sugar, creating a smooth, rich, and sweet base.

* Slightly grainy: You can still feel the texture of the cooked rice, which adds a slight chewiness.

* Mild: It's not overly flavorful, leaving room for other ingredients to shine.

Variations:

* Vanilla: Often flavored with vanilla extract, adding a warm and comforting note.

* Cinnamon: A classic pairing that adds a spicy kick.

* Nutmeg: Creates a warm and slightly sweet flavor.

* Fruit: Fruits like berries, apples, or pears can be added for sweetness and acidity.

* Chocolate: A decadent addition with a rich and creamy flavor.

* Spices: Other spices like cardamom, ginger, or saffron can be used for unique flavor profiles.

Overall:

Rice pudding is a comforting and satisfying dessert that is both sweet and creamy with a slight grainy texture. The specific flavor profile will vary depending on the ingredients used. It is a versatile dish that can be adapted to different tastes and preferences.
